A gap between the sash's frame and the frame could be the reason behind your windows not closing properly. This could cause drafts, but it could also cause water damage and damp. You can test it by putting some paper between the frame and the sash, to see if the sash can be shut.

To repair this, you'll need to remove the seal around the frame and sash. Then, you'll have to remove the locking gearbox from its position within the frame. This will require the assistance of a tool such as a flat screwdriver as well as a torch to access the gearbox. After you have removed your gearbox, you'll need to replace it with a brand new one that is the same model and size.
